问题标签 [voting]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
128 浏览

ruby-on-rails - 为什么这个 Ruby on Rails 代码没有按我的预期工作?

所以我试图建立我在这个问题中提出的问题:修复投票机制

但是,此解决方案不起作用。用户仍然可以随意投票多次。我该如何解决这个问题和/或重构?

0 投票
2 回答
271 浏览

ruby-on-rails - 为什么这个 Ruby on Rails 投票代码不起作用?

所以我真的认为这将有助于创建我们在 SO 上的投票系统:

我尝试按照这个问题中第一个答案的示例进行操作:为什么这个 Ruby on Rails 代码没有按我的预期工作?但是,由于此错误,我的代码不允许我第一次对视频进行投票:

这是我的视频投票模型:

如果需要,这是vote_sum我的视频模型中的方法:

0 投票
2 回答
202 浏览

ruby-on-rails - 为队列中即将过期的项目构建投票系统的最佳方法是什么?需要后台任务吗?

我正在 Rails 3(和 Ruby 1.9.2)中构建一个应用程序,它接受来自多个用户的提交。该应用程序会在 X 时间后关闭提交窗口。然后,每个人都要对提交的内容进行投票(赞成/反对)。在 Y 时间后,得票最多的人“获胜”,然后重复该过程。

我是一个菜鸟,但我已经构建了包含提交、RESTful 路由、使用 Devise 的用户身份验证等的基本模型。但是现在我的经验已经用完了,我不太确定构建“持有”系统,该系统将倒计时,直到没有票被接受并选出获胜者。我想我会创建一个投票对象,这样每次提交可以有很多票。但似乎可能需要在后台启动某些东西,以便在投票的计时器用完后唤醒并说:“好的,这个投票期已经结束,现在将获胜者移入数据库并在下一轮投票之前开始接受新的提交”。这是正确的还是可以比这更简单?

关于我应该如何思考这个概念的任何建议?

谢谢!!

0 投票
2 回答
494 浏览

android - 将Android与数据库连接

我正在做一个关于电子投票的学术项目,我需要将 Android 应用程序与我在 xammp 中设计的 MySQL 数据库连接起来。另外,我正在使用 eclipse 程序来完成我的项目。

你能帮我找到将android与xammp连接的方法吗?

0 投票
2 回答
53 浏览

sql - 如何优化我的投票应用程序以生成月度图表?

感谢您提供的任何帮助 - 我目前正在尝试为我正在使用 PHP / MySQL 构建的投票应用程序确定架构,但我完全不知道如何优化它。关键要素是每个用户每个项目只允许投一票,并且能够根据当月收到的投票建立一个详细说明当月热门项目的图表。

到目前为止,初始模式是:

所以我想知道是否会从投票表中选择所有信息,其中月份 = currentMonth & year = currentYear,以某种方式运行计数并按 item_id 分组;如果是这样,我将如何去做?或者我会更好地为每个投票更新的月度图表创建一个单独的表,但是我应该关心每次投票更新 3 个数据库表的要求吗?

我不是特别称职——如果它表明的话——所以我真的很喜欢有人可以提供的任何帮助/指导。

谢谢,

_只有我

0 投票
1 回答
782 浏览

javascript - ASP.NET 中的轮询控件

我想制作一个投票控件,允许用户对一个选项进行投票并查看结果,我不知道是否有现成的控件可以在 ASP.NET 或 JavaScript 中实现,或者我必须从从头开始,请如果有人可以帮助我。我会很感激的。

提前致谢。

0 投票
2 回答
1061 浏览

php - 统计正负票数:

我有以下表格:

值是可以是 1 或 -1 的 tiny_int。

我想统计每个帖子的正面和负面投票数:

为什么下面的代码不起作用?

我还尝试了以下方法,这导致每个帖子的所有投票都相同:

还有什么方法可以做到这一点,而不必为每个帖子多次查询数据库?不断变化的[像这样]如何被(mem)缓存?

0 投票
2 回答
442 浏览

php - 数组查询 PHP + mongoDB - 投票系统 ips

你能帮帮我吗?我在 php + mongodb 中制作我的投票系统,我想保留已经投票的 ip 地址。最好的方法是什么?我正在考虑这样做:

$ip=$_SERVER['REMOTE_ADDR'];
$ipData = array('$push' => array('ips' => $ip), '$inc' => array('votes' => 1));
$collection->update(array( '_id' => $id), $ipData);

这是最好的方法吗?您将如何比较ips数组的所有元素以查看该 ip 是否尚未投票?该列表将如下所示(192.168.0.1, 127.0.0.1, 123.45.67.8)

谢谢!

0 投票
1 回答
2225 浏览

sql - Reddit 如何排序查询他们的数据库中的“热门内容”?

我想在我的网站上实现类似的东西。

提交有 up_votes 和 down_votes。我想 reddit 会进行某种数据库查询,该查询会考虑 up_votes 与 total_votes 以及可能影响 # of view 和 # of comments 的因素,并将其全部限制在指定的时间段内。

您认为他们使用哪种查询来确定这一点?

谢谢!

0 投票
1 回答
1054 浏览

javascript - JQuery + thumbs_up gem 渲染投票计数?

插件: Thumbs Up & JQuery 1.5.2(需要另一个旧 gem)

当用户对帖子进行投票时,我正在尝试使用完整的 HTTP 请求呈现更新的投票计数。目前,它会在每次投票时刷新页面。

职位控制器

投票视图(每个帖子 div 左侧有一个投票 div(digg/reddit 样式),右侧有内容)

vote_up.erb.js(在帖子文件夹中)。

我已经坚持了一段时间,非常感谢你能提供的任何帮助。我已经看过 Jquery railscast 并查看了其他 Stackoverflow 答案,但我对 Jquery 仍然很陌生。